What does an assistant to the chairman do?

An Assistant to the Chairman provides high-level administrative and organizational support to the chairman of a company or organization. This role often involves managing schedules, coordinating meetings, preparing reports and presentations, handling confidential information, and acting as a liaison between the chairman and other stakeholders. The assistant may also be responsible for travel arrangements, communication management, and supporting special projects as needed. Strong communication, organizational, and problem-solving skills are essential in this position.

What are some common challenges faced by an assistant to the chairman, and how can they be navigated effectively?

An Assistant to the Chairman often manages highly confidential information, coordinates complex schedules, and acts as a liaison between the Chairman and internal or external stakeholders. Balancing shifting priorities and maintaining discretion can be challenging, especially in fast-paced environments. Success in this role requires strong organizational skills, proactive communication, and the ability to anticipate the Chairman's needs. Building trust and staying adaptable are key to overcoming these challenges and ensuring seamless support.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an assistant to the chairman,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Assistant to the Chairman, you need strong organizational abilities, attention to detail, and experience managing complex schedules, often supported by a bachelor's degree in business or a related field. Familiarity with office productivity software, calendar management tools, and sometimes CRM systems is commonly required. Excellent communication, discretion, and proactive problem-solving are standout soft skills in this role. These competencies are vital for ensuring seamless executive support, maintaining confidentiality, and enabling the Chairman to focus on high-level strategic priorities.

What is the difference between Assistant To The Chairman vs Executive Assistant?

AspectAssistant To The ChairmanExecutive Assistant
Primary RoleSupports the Chairman with strategic and high-level administrative tasksSupports executives with administrative, scheduling, and communication tasks
Work EnvironmentCorporate boardrooms, executive officesOffice settings across various industries
Required CredentialsOften requires experience in corporate administration, strong communication skillsSimilar credentials, often with additional secretarial or administrative certifications

While both roles involve high-level administrative support, the Assistant To The Chairman focuses on assisting the Chairman with strategic and executive tasks, whereas the Executive Assistant typically supports other senior executives with day-to-day administrative duties.
